THE ORDER OF AUGUSTINIAN RECOLLECTS CHARITABLE TRUST
The Order fulfils its principal aims through (a) formation, training and continuing education and the promotion of vocations to the Priesthood and religious life (Vocations Promotions) and (b) by prayer and pastoral work in parishes. The work includes teaching, preaching, retreat-giving, chaplaincy in schools and hospitals, and care of the elderly.
Financial health, per its FY2024 accounts
The accounts state that free reserves amounted to £749,603 at 31 December 2022, a decrease from the previous year. The Trustees consider this level of free reserves to be 'barely adequate' in light of their commitment to look after the friars in future years, particularly regarding retirement and nursing care needs. The charity reported a net expenditure for the year, relying on parish income and donations to sustain its charitable activities.
What the accounts disclose
“The calculations, based on actuarial principles, indicated that it was necessary to set aside in excess of £1,360,000 of funds in order to provide modest future resources to meet the needs of the Recollects in the years to come.”

Income and spending
| Financial year end |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 31/12/2024 | £155k | £192k |
| 31/12/2023 | £128k | £141k |
| 31/12/2022 | £98k | £145k |
| 31/12/2021 | £130k | £157k |
| 31/12/2020 | £79k | £177k |
